This NIC enables reliable network connectivity for industrial communication gateways, facilitating data transmission between manufacturing equipment and control systems in computer and electronic product manufacturing environments.
Constructed with a Printed Circuit Board (PCB), integrated circuits, copper connectors, and plastic housing to withstand industrial environments while maintaining optimal signal integrity and network performance.
The BOM includes a Connector Port for physical connections, MAC Controller for data link layer management, Magnetics Module for signal isolation, and PHY Chip for physical layer signal processing.
